Philippine player Alexandra Eala claimed the Washington Women's Open Tennis Championship (500-point category) title after defeating American Jessica Pegula in three sets. The match was interrupted due to bad weather and was resumed today. Eala, ranked 20th worldwide, secured her first title in the 500-point category, having previously won titles in the 125-point category. The competition was intense; she lost the first set (4-6) but came back to win the next two (6-4 and 6-0). Pegula, ranked third in the world and the top seed in the tournament, missed out on her twelfth career title.
